Embracer strikes deal with New Line and Warner Bros for new Lord of the Rings films | News-in-brief

Partnership was signed via subsidiary Middle-earth Enterprises for multiple movies based on Tolkien's work

This is a News-in-brief article, our short format linking to an official source for more information

  • Embracer Group has announced a partnership with New Line Cinema and Warner Bros Pictures
  • The deal encompasses "multiple films" based on JRR Tolkien's work including The Lord of the Rings and The Hobbit
